Fort Pierce utility authority approves $8.7 million guaranteed‑maximum price for Lift Station A upgrades and downtown force main

FORT PIERCE, Fla. — The Fort Pierce Utility Authority on June 3 approved Amendment 3 to its progressive design‑build master agreement, establishing a guaranteed maximum price (GMP) of $8,700,000 for CIP1, a project that upgrades Lift Station A and installs a downtown force main to route wastewater west to a new mainland treatment plant.

The board’s vote followed a presentation from utility staff outlining the Phase 1a conveyance projects, construction progress on the Jenkins Road force main, and the package of federal and state grants that will reimburse bond proceeds used to fund the work. The motion passed on a roll call vote with Mrs. Bennett, Mrs. Davis, Mayor Hudson and Mrs. Gibbons voting yes; one member, Mr. Fee, was absent and excused earlier in the meeting.

Why it matters: The work is part of a multi‑phase effort to redirect wastewater flow from the island treatment facility to a new mainland municipal wastewater reclamation facility (MWRF) that staff expect to commission in December 2025, barring major storm disruption. Redirecting flow is required to operate the new plant efficiently and to reduce long‑term operation and maintenance costs.
